Transaction 161cc9bcbe88bf4e750eaed93f905884f4cec9ec9fc6523d58aea8ba7e6cf827
1 Input
1 Output
-
161cc9bcbe88bf4e750eaed93f905884f4cec9ec9fc6523d58aea8ba7e6cf827:0
- value
- 528733
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e93edcffd300fc070d1d05bca88fb7a603940995 OP_EQUAL
- address
- 3NxJg4HNw84bHPciUt3S2WZR6N5BjACALp